Lord of flies written by William Golding reveals the rivalry between the two boys Jack and Ralph.

Step-by-step explanation:

Jack and ralph see themselves in an uninhabited island. Gradually, they develop rules and try to stick on to it. But inherently, they prove their leadership and power in different situations. From their struggles we can understand that humans are savaged in nature and out of chaos come the order of life.

Ralph is forced to accept his weakness and becomes rude and harsh and his control over other boys seems to weaken which makes him think more cruelly. This suggests that human’ violent impulses are more dangerous than the civilized person’.
